Tintin Comic Could Be Banned

A Congolese student has launched a court case denouncing the comic book Tintin in the Congo as racist, calling for its withdrawal from sale, the Brussels prosecutor’s office said. It is not the first time that the book, featuring late Belgian author and illustrator Herge’s popular red-headed boy journalist Tintin and his faithful dog Snowy, has raised hackles over its content.

Change To eBay Feedback System

I ran across this post on the eBay’s Strategy Blog

In summation, it reports that eBay is now considering “neutral” feedback scores as negatives. From a selling perspective, that concerns me. We try our darndest to ensure all customers have a good experience. Unfortunately there are always going to be people who are unsatisfied. They didn’t have a negative experience, they just weren’t in a particularly good mood and the product wasn’t free.

I personally appreciate receiving a neutral score in situations like that rather than a negative.
